excel表格中宏的是什么
作者:路由通
|
181人看过
发布时间:2026-02-16 19:54:50
标签:
在Excel(电子表格软件)中,宏是一种强大的自动化工具,它允许用户录制或编写代码来执行重复性任务,从而显著提升工作效率。本质上,宏是一系列预先定义好的指令集合,能够模拟用户的操作,实现数据的批量处理、复杂计算流程的自动化以及自定义功能的添加。理解宏的概念、工作原理、应用场景与安全风险,是每一位希望深度掌握Excel(电子表格软件)的用户的必修课。
在日常办公与数据处理中,微软的Excel(电子表格软件)无疑是不可或缺的工具。然而,当面对成百上千行数据的重复操作,或是需要执行一系列固定步骤的复杂报表生成时,手动操作不仅效率低下,还极易出错。此时,一个名为“宏”的功能便悄然登场,成为许多资深用户手中的效率“神器”。那么,Excel(电子表格软件)表格中的宏究竟是什么?它如何运作,又能为我们带来哪些变革性的帮助?本文将深入浅出,为您全面解析宏的奥秘。
一、宏的本质定义:自动化的指令集 简单来说,宏是一系列命令和指令的组合,它们被存储在一个Visual Basic for Applications(可视化基础应用程序)模块中,可以被随时调用以自动执行任务。您可以将其理解为一个忠实且不知疲倦的“数字助理”,它能够精确复现您预先设定好的一系列操作。无论是简单的格式刷、数据排序,还是复杂的多表关联、公式迭代,宏都能一键完成。它的核心价值在于,将人工的、重复的、有规律的操作流程,转化为计算机可识别和执行的自动化脚本。 二、宏的实现原理:录制与编程双路径 创建宏主要有两种方式,适应不同技术背景的用户。第一种是“录制宏”,这是最直观易懂的方式。用户只需开启录制功能,随后像平常一样在Excel(电子表格软件)中进行操作,如输入数据、设置格式、使用函数等。操作结束后停止录制,Excel(电子表格软件)便会自动将这些步骤翻译成Visual Basic for Applications(可视化基础应用程序)代码并保存。下次需要执行相同操作时,运行该宏即可。第二种是直接编写Visual Basic for Applications(可视化基础应用程序)代码,这为用户提供了无限的定制能力和逻辑控制空间,可以实现条件判断、循环处理、用户交互等复杂功能,是宏功能的高级形态。 三、宏的存储位置:个人宏工作簿与特定工作簿 理解宏的存储位置对于管理它至关重要。宏可以保存在两个主要位置:一是“个人宏工作簿”,这是一个隐藏的工作簿文件,其中保存的宏可以在您打开任何Excel(电子表格软件)文件时使用,非常适合存放通用性强的自动化工具。二是“当前工作簿”,宏仅保存在特定的Excel(电子表格软件)文件中,只有打开该文件时才能使用其中的宏。这种存储方式便于将宏与特定的数据处理模板或报告捆绑在一起,方便分发和协作。 四、宏的核心语言:Visual Basic for Applications(可视化基础应用程序)简介 宏的背后,是微软内置的Visual Basic for Applications(可视化基础应用程序)编程语言。这是一种基于Visual Basic(可视化基础)的宏语言,专门为Office(办公软件)系列应用程序设计。即使您不是专业程序员,通过录制宏生成的代码,也能一窥其语法结构,并尝试进行简单的修改。学习基础的Visual Basic for Applications(可视化基础应用程序)知识,能让您从宏的“使用者”进阶为“创造者”,解锁更强大的自动化能力。 五、宏的典型应用场景:从简单到复杂 宏的应用几乎覆盖了Excel(电子表格软件)使用的所有痛点领域。例如,在数据清洗方面,宏可以自动删除空行、统一日期格式、拆分或合并单元格内容。在报表自动化方面,它可以定时从多个数据源汇总数据,生成固定格式的图表和仪表盘。在日常办公中,它可以自动发送带附件的邮件、批量打印调整好页面的文档。对于财务、人事、销售等需要处理大量固定格式数据的岗位,宏能节省大量时间,将员工从繁琐劳动中解放出来。 六、宏的安全性考量:一把双刃剑 强大的功能往往伴随着潜在的风险。由于宏可以执行几乎任何操作,它也成为恶意代码的潜在载体。因此,Excel(电子表格软件)默认设置了较高的宏安全级别。在打开包含宏的文件时,软件会发出明确警告,用户需要手动选择“启用内容”后宏才能运行。这是一个重要的安全机制,提醒用户只应启用来自可信来源的宏。对于自行编写或录制的宏,则无需过分担心。 七、启用与信任宏:安全设置详解 为了平衡功能与安全,Excel(电子表格软件)提供了多层次的宏安全设置。用户可以在“信任中心”进行配置。通常,建议将宏设置设为“禁用所有宏,并发出通知”。这样,在打开含宏文件时,您会看到消息栏的提示,从而有机会判断文件来源是否可靠。对于确定安全的文件或自己开发的工具,可以将其所在文件夹添加为“受信任位置”,该位置下的文件打开时宏将直接启用,无需每次确认。 八、宏的录制实战:一步步创建您的第一个宏 理论需结合实践。让我们尝试录制一个简单宏:将选定区域的字体设置为加粗、红色,并添加边框。首先,在“开发工具”选项卡中点击“录制宏”,为其命名并指定快捷键。然后,执行上述格式设置操作。完成后点击“停止录制”。现在,选中另一个区域,按下您设置的快捷键,或者从宏列表中运行它,您会发现所有格式被瞬间应用。这个过程直观展示了宏如何将多步操作压缩为一步。 九、查看与编辑代码:走进Visual Basic for Applications(可视化基础应用程序)编辑器 录制宏后,您可以进入Visual Basic for Applications(可视化基础应用程序)编辑器查看生成的代码。通过快捷键或者“开发工具”选项卡中的“Visual Basic”按钮即可打开这个集成开发环境。在这里,您可以看到以“Sub”开头、以“End Sub”结尾的代码块,这就是宏的主体。您会看到诸如“Selection.Font.Bold = True”这样的语句,它们直接对应了您录制的操作。尝试修改其中的参数,例如将“True”改为“False”,再次运行宏,观察效果变化,这是学习宏编程的第一步。 十、从录制到编程:实现条件逻辑 录制的宏是线性的,无法做判断。而直接编程可以实现智能化的宏。例如,您可以编写一个宏,让它遍历某一列的所有单元格,如果单元格的值大于100,则将其标记为黄色。这需要使用“For Each...Next”循环语句和“If...Then”条件判断语句。通过引入这些编程逻辑,宏不再是简单的动作回放,而成为了一个具备初步“思考”能力的自动化流程,能够应对更加复杂和多变的数据处理需求。 十一、宏的调试与错误处理 编写复杂的宏时,难免会出现错误。Visual Basic for Applications(可视化基础应用程序)编辑器提供了强大的调试工具,如“逐语句”运行、设置断点、查看变量值等,帮助您定位问题所在。此外,良好的编程习惯还包括加入错误处理代码,例如使用“On Error Resume Next”或“On Error GoTo”语句,使宏在遇到非致命错误时能够继续运行或优雅地退出,而不是直接崩溃,这对于制作给他人使用的宏尤为重要。 十二、宏的共享与部署 当您开发出一个好用的宏,可能会希望与同事共享。如果宏保存在“个人宏工作簿”中,它仅存在于您的电脑上。共享宏通常有两种方式:一是将宏代码复制到同事电脑的模块中;二是将包含宏的工作簿文件直接发送给对方,并指导对方调整宏安全设置以启用它。对于团队内频繁使用的工具,可以考虑将工作簿文件放在共享网络驱动器上,或将宏代码封装成加载项,以实现更便捷的部署和管理。 十三、宏的局限性认知 尽管功能强大,宏也有其边界。首先,它的运行严重依赖于Excel(电子表格软件)桌面应用程序环境,无法在Excel Online(在线电子表格软件)等网页版中运行大多数宏。其次,对于极其庞大复杂的计算或需要连接外部数据库进行高频交互的任务,专业的编程语言或数据库工具可能更为合适。最后,过于复杂或编写不佳的宏可能导致执行效率低下。了解这些局限,有助于我们在合适的场景选择最合适的工具。 十四、与其它自动化工具的对比 在自动化领域,宏并非唯一选择。例如,微软Power Query(强大查询)专注于数据的获取、转换和加载,提供了图形化界面来处理数据清洗和整合。而Power Pivot(强大数据透视)则专注于数据建模和大规模数据分析。与这些工具相比,宏的优势在于其灵活性和对Excel(电子表格软件)对象模型(如单元格、图表、工作表)的精细控制能力。通常,在实际项目中,这些工具可以协同工作,由Power Query(强大查询)准备数据,由Power Pivot(强大数据透视)建立模型,再由宏来完成最后的报表格式定制与批量输出,形成完整的自动化流水线。 十五、学习资源与进阶方向 对于希望深入学习宏和Visual Basic for Applications(可视化基础应用程序)的用户,有许多优质资源可供利用。微软官方文档提供了最权威的语法和对象模型参考。互联网上有大量的教程、论坛和社区,可以找到针对具体问题的解决方案和代码示例。从录制宏开始,逐步尝试阅读和修改代码,然后挑战编写简单的自定义函数,最终实现带有用户窗体的交互式工具,是一条可行的学习路径。掌握这项技能,无疑会极大提升您在数据分析职场中的竞争力。 十六、总结:拥抱自动化,释放创造力 归根结底,Excel(电子表格软件)中的宏是一种将重复性劳动自动化的思想和技术实现。它降低了编程的门槛,让每一位业务人员都有可能成为解决自身效率问题的“开发者”。理解它,不仅是学习一个软件功能,更是培养一种通过自动化提升效能的思维方式。从今天开始,尝试为您每周都要做的那个固定报表录制一个宏,您将亲身体会到技术带来的解放感,从而有更多精力专注于那些更需要人类智慧和创造力的工作中去。
相关文章
串联型稳压电路是线性稳压技术中的核心架构,其基本原理是通过一个与负载串联连接的可控调整元件,动态调节其两端的电压降,从而在输入电压或负载电流变化时,维持输出电压的恒定。这种电路结构清晰,反馈控制直接,具备输出纹波小、瞬态响应相对较快的特点,是基础电子设备中稳定直流供电的经典解决方案。
2026-02-16 19:54:47
292人看过
铝壳电机是一种采用铝合金材质制造外壳的电动机,其设计兼顾了轻量化、散热效率与结构强度。相较于传统铸铁电机,它在重量上减轻约三分之一,同时具备优良的导热与防腐蚀性能,广泛应用于工业自动化、家用电器及新能源汽车等领域。本文将深入解析铝壳电机的结构特点、工作原理、性能优势及选型要点,为读者提供一份全面的技术指南。
2026-02-16 19:54:44
120人看过
功率方向是电力系统中衡量能量流动路径与趋势的核心概念,它特指在交流电路中,电能沿着输电线路或电气设备传输的既定方向。这一方向不仅由电压与电流的相位关系精确界定,更深刻影响着电网的潮流分布、保护装置的精准动作以及系统的稳定运行。理解功率方向,是掌握电力系统分析、继电保护配置乃至新能源并网管理等关键技术的基础。
2026-02-16 19:54:39
210人看过
在日常的文字处理中,微软的办公软件默认采用何种字体,往往是许多用户,特别是初次接触者,会感到好奇的一个基础却重要的问题。本文将深入探讨这款软件中默认字体的历史沿革、设计考量、在不同版本与系统环境下的差异,以及如何根据实际需求进行合理选择和高效管理,旨在为用户提供一份全面且实用的指南。
2026-02-16 19:53:43
224人看过
在使用文字处理软件进行文档打印时,许多用户会遇到无法打印背景颜色或背景图像的问题。这通常与软件默认设置、打印机驱动限制、文档格式兼容性以及打印选项的特定配置有关。本文将深入探讨导致这一现象的十二个核心原因,并提供一系列经过验证的解决方案,帮助您全面理解并彻底解决背景打印的难题。
2026-02-16 19:53:33
320人看过
提及“6p手机”,人们常联想到苹果公司(Apple Inc.)在2014年推出的iPhone 6 Plus。其屏幕尺寸为5.5英寸,但具体以厘米为单位的长宽高以及整体机身尺寸,是许多用户关心的实用数据。本文将依据官方技术规格,深入解析iPhone 6 Plus的确切尺寸,探讨其设计对握持手感、便携性及视觉体验的影响,并对比同期及现代机型,帮助读者全面理解这款经典机型在尺寸定义上的意义与遗产。
2026-02-16 19:53:27
271人看过
热门推荐
资讯中心:
.webp)


.webp)
.webp)